RyderAt the College of Engineering and Science awards banquet in April, Dean Gramopadhye and Dr. Hirt presented Trey Ryder with the Western S.C. Section AIChE Scholastic Achievement Award.   This award is presented to the graduating senior in Chemical & Biomolecular Engineering with the highest scholastic average.

The department ChBE Undergraduate Researcher of the Year Award was presented to Samuel Leguizamon.   This award is presented each year to the undergraduate who performs at the highest level of distinction in research.

The ChBE Junior of the Year Award went to Andrew Carlin.   Andrew was given this award for completing his junior year with the highest scholastic average.

And Seth Elliott was presented the Western S.C. AIChE Section Scholarship.

In other news, Shelby Thies, an undergraduate honors student who works in Dr. Husson’s research group, was accepted to the Radiochemistry Fuel Cycle Summer School at the University of Las Vegas.   Acceptance to the program is very competitive and she will spend 6 weeks learning about radioanalytical chemistry and taking tours of Department of Energy facilities.
